Hey, it's the North American Version....Driver....and I'm on the scenario where it's like "Camp 2" or something like that. I have to hook to a set of skeleton trailers, move forward, then reverse onto the loading track where there's a crane operator. A message pops up and tells me to reverse until the first skeleton car, the one right behind the flat bed trailer, is under the crane, stop and then after it's loaded to pull forward until each car is individually loaded...but I can't get it to load any of them...

You must place the middle of the skeleton car just under the hook of the crane, and it will load. The logs will show up on the car.
